## Changelog — Lattice Timetabler 2.4.1

- Fixed constraint solver deadlock when two cohorts share a lab block at Pembervale Academy fixtures.
- Room-capacity penalties now scale linearly; removed quadratic term that starved small classrooms.
- Teacher availability windows respect half-day granularity.
- Solver seed is logged per run for reproducibility.
- Dropped legacy CSV import; use the Roster bundle format.
- Benchmarks: 18% faster on the Thistledown sample set.

All changes reviewed and merged by the release owner named below.

named custodian: Ulaix Ulaath

☐ Cron drift follow-up (Key Ceremony step 4) — Before we seal the Tumblewick scheduler keys, double-check the drift investigation notes from the Larkspur incident. The cron host was slipping ~40s per day, so any timestamps in the ceremony log from before the NTP fix are suspect. Support folks: if a customer asks why their nightly export fired late last week, that's why. Once the drift report is attached and signed off by two witnesses, unlock the escrow folder. The passphrase for the escrow bundle is below.

strongbox words: sorir-belvan-rusix-ulays-ralmir-praix-eliir-tamax-praael-druael-julir-tamius-jorir

Hey team — handing this one over before I head out. The flaky DNS thing on Quillhaven staging is still biting us roughly once an hour. Resolution to the upstream resolver times out, retries succeed, so users mostly see slow pages rather than hard failures. Marisol and I narrowed it to the sidecar cache expiring entries too aggressively under load. Don't restart the resolver pods; that just masks it for twenty minutes. The current resolver settings on staging are as follows:

deployment values, kajep-kageg:
[praix]
host = praix.paliqcorp.corp
user = praix_svc
database = praix_prod